The Roots of Country Style: Comfort Meets Necessity
To truly appreciate the nuanced appeal of country glam, one must first understand the fundamental principles that shaped traditional country style. At its core, country fashion is, and always has been, about comfort and convenience. This fashion style arose from necessity because cowboys and cowgirls worked long hours outside with cattle, horses, and other livestock. Their daily lives demanded clothing that was not only durable and functional but also provided protection from the elements, whether it was the scorching sun, biting wind, or rough terrain. Think of the quintessential elements: sturdy denim jeans that could withstand wear and tear, practical leather boots designed for riding and walking, and wide-brimmed hats offering crucial sun protection. These weren't fashion statements in their inception; they were tools, integral to survival and productivity in a demanding environment. This foundation of utility and resilience is precisely what gives country style its enduring appeal and authenticity. It’s a testament to a lifestyle built on hard work, self-reliance, and a deep connection to the land. Over time, as the romanticized image of the American West permeated popular culture through literature, film, and music, these practical garments transcended their original purpose. They evolved into iconic fashion statements, symbolizing freedom, independence, and a distinct American spirit. The denim jeans became a global staple, the leather boots a symbol of rugged individuality, and the plaid shirts a nod to heritage. The subtle shift from pure utility to a fashion statement began as designers and wearers alike started to incorporate subtle embellishments, tailored fits, and more refined materials, paving the way for the glamorous evolution we see today.
What Exactly is Country Glam? Defining the Aesthetic
So, with its practical origins in mind, what exactly sets country glam apart from traditional Western wear? It's the masterful and artful fusion of two seemingly disparate worlds: the rustic, earthy, and often rugged elements of country life, and the opulent, sophisticated, and often sparkling touches of glamour. Imagine the raw, textured feel of a classic denim jacket juxtaposed with the shimmering elegance of sequined accents, or a pair of time-honored cowboy boots adorned with intricate, sparkling embroidery. It’s fundamentally about balance – a delicate, intentional dance between raw authenticity and refined elegance. This style proudly asserts that it doesn't like to be boxed into one single style or aesthetic; instead, it wholeheartedly embraces versatility and a spirit of playful experimentation. It’s about taking the familiar, comforting silhouettes and materials of country fashion and elevating them with luxurious fabrics, thoughtful, eye-catching accessories, and a touch of undeniable sparkle. Think less "dusty barn dance" and significantly more "Nashville red carpet" or a high-end equestrian event. The overarching goal of country glam is to achieve a look that feels effortlessly chic, as if you’ve just stepped out of a high-fashion photoshoot set against a breathtaking rural backdrop. It’s a celebration of beautiful contrasts, proving unequivocally that opposites truly do attract, and indeed thrive, in the dynamic world of fashion.
- Rustic Meets Refined: This core principle involves combining natural, durable textures like denim, distressed leather, and breathable cotton with more luxurious and delicate fabrics such as silk, intricate lace, soft chiffon, or lustrous satin. The contrast creates visual interest and depth.
- Comfort with Sparkle: While prioritizing comfortable, wearable silhouettes that allow for ease of movement, country glam strategically adds elements of shine and shimmer. This can manifest as rhinestones, metallic threads, subtle glitter, or delicate, eye-catching jewelry that catches the light.
- Authenticity with Polish: It means maintaining the integrity and recognizable charm of traditional Western motifs – like fringe details, classic boot shapes, and iconic hat styles – but presenting them in a more polished, contemporary, and often elevated manner. This could involve cleaner lines, higher-quality materials, or modern interpretations of classic designs.

Denim Duo: The Foundation of Country Chic
Denim is, without a doubt, the undisputed king of country fashion, and in the dynamic realm of country glam, it takes on a renewed sense of versatility and importance. It’s no longer confined solely to jeans; the possibilities expand to include stylish denim jackets, chic skirts, elegant dresses, and even well-tailored shirts. To truly achieve a country chic look, you’ll need to incorporate denim essentials into your wardrobe in a thoughtful way. The key here is to choose denim with a modern fit, perhaps a flattering high-waist, a contemporary bootcut, or a sleek skinny cut, and ideally, with a subtle touch of embellishment or a unique wash. A chic country glam outfit inspo often prominently features a well-fitting denim jacket, perhaps slightly oversized or with a tailored cut, artfully thrown over a more delicate dress or a soft, flowy top. Consider distressed denim for an edgy, lived-in touch that adds character, or opt for dark-wash, unblemished denim for a more polished and sophisticated feel. Denim acts as the perfect, grounding canvas for your outfit, providing that essential touch of rustic authenticity while allowing more glamorous elements to truly shine. It’s the ultimate versatile fabric, capable of being dressed up or down with remarkable ease, making it an indispensable cornerstone for any country glam enthusiast’s closet.
- Classic Jeans: Invest in a few pairs of well-fitting jeans. High-waisted styles offer a modern silhouette, bootcut jeans are perfect for pairing with cowboy boots, and skinny jeans provide a sleek base for more voluminous tops or jackets. Experiment with washes from light vintage blue to dark indigo.
- Denim Jacket: An absolute must-have for layering and adding that instant cool factor. Look for options with subtle embellishments like pearl snaps, stud details, or intricate embroidery. A slightly oversized fit can add a relaxed, stylish vibe.
- Denim Skirts & Dresses: From playful mini skirts to elegant maxi dresses, denim dresses and skirts offer a fresh, contemporary take on the classic fabric. A denim midi skirt with a slit or a button-front denim dress can be surprisingly glamorous when paired with the right accessories.
